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
-
Graham Cracker Crumbs: These provide a deliciously sweet and crunchy base; feel free to crush your own or buy pre-made.
-
Sugar: A touch of granulated sugar balances the flavors beautifully without overpowering the pumpkin.
-
Unsalted Butter: Melted butter helps bind the crust together for that perfect crunch.
-
Cream Cheese: Use full-fat cream cheese for the creamiest texture; it’s worth it!
-
Pumpkin Puree: Always opt for pure pumpkin puree—not pie filling—to control sweetness and spices.
-
Powdered Sugar: This dissolves easily into the filling, giving it that silky smoothness we love.
-
Vanilla Extract: A splash enhances all the flavors and adds depth to your cheesecake.
-
Pumpkin Spice: A blend of c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ger brings that classic fall flavor profile.
-
Whipped Cream (for topping): Whipped cream adds an airy finish and makes everything feel extra special.

Let’s Make it Together
Prepare the Crust: Begin by mixing graham cracker crumbs with sugar and melted butter until well combined.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of a springform pan for a sturdy crust.
Make the Filling: In a large mixing bowl, beat cream cheese until smooth. Gradually add powdered sugar while continuing to mix until fully incorporated—no lumps allowed!
Add Pumpkin Goodness: Stir in pumpkin puree along with vanilla extract and pumpkin spice. Mix until everything is beautifully blended into a luscious filling.
Assemble Your Cheesecake: Pour the smooth filling over your prepared crust. Spread it evenly using a spatula to ensure every slice looks gorgeous.
Chill Time!: Cover your cheesecake with plastic wrap or foil and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ight if you can resist temptation that long!
Serve & Enjoy!: When you’re ready to serve, top each slice with whipped cream and maybe even some extra pumpkin spice for flair. Enjoy every last bite while basking in compliments from friends and family!

Storing &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to five days. This cheesecake is best enjoyed chilled, so there’s no need to reheat it.
Chef's Helpful Tips
- For a silky texture, ensure your cream cheese is at room temperature before mixing
- Avoid overmixing when adding whipped cream to keep it fluffy
- Always taste as you go; adjusting sweetness or spices makes a world of difference!

FAQ
Can I use fresh pumpkin puree instead of canned?
Absolutely! Just make sure it’s well-drained to avoid excess moisture.
How can I make this cheesecake gluten-free?
Use gluten-free graham crackers or a nut-based crust for a delicious alternative.
What toppings pair well with No Bake Pumpkin Cheesecake?
Whipped cream, caramel sauce, or pecans add delightful textures and flavors to this dessert.
No Bake Pumpkin Cheesecake
- Total Time: 44 minute
- Yield: Serves 12 1x
Description
No Bake Pumpkin Cheesecake is the ultimate fall dessert, combining velvety pumpkin flavor with a buttery graham cracker crust. This effortless recipe requires no baking, making it perfect for gatherings or cozy nights in. Topped with whipped cream and a sprinkle of pumpkin spice, this cheesecake captures the essence of autumn in every delicious bite.
Ingredients
- 1 ½ cups graham cracker crumbs
- ½ cup granulated sugar
- ½ cup unsalted butter, melted
- 16 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up pumpkin puree
- 2 cups powdered sugar
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 tsp pumpkin spice
- Whipped cream (for topping)
Instructions
- Prepare the crust by mixing graham cracker crumbs, granulated sugar, and melted butter until well combined. Press firmly into the bottom of a springform pan.
- Beat cream cheese in a large bowl until smooth. Gradually add powdered sugar until fully mixed.
- Stir in pumpkin puree, vanilla extract, and pumpkin spice until blended.
- Pour the filling over the crust and spread evenly.
- Cover with plastic wrap or foil and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ight.
- Serve chilled, topped with whipped cream and additional pumpkin spice if desired.
